Analysis

The most recent figure for share of children vaccinated against measles vs. against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is in Eswatini is 86.0%, measured in 2024.

The figure is up 4.9% on the previous year and down 3.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of children vaccinated against measles vs. against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is in Eswatini peaked at 96.0% in 2002 and was at its lowest, 0.0%, in 2000.

That places Eswatini 86th out of 194 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.

Shown is the second-dose measles vaccination coverage of children against the DTP3 vaccination coverage of 12 to 23 month old children. The age at which children receive the second vaccination of measles varies between countries but is typically between 15 months and 6 years old.
